Comedic Legends to Appear in ‘Toy Story 4’ as Abandoned Toys

The Toy Story series is well known for its extensive cast of big name celebrities. Whether it’s one-time performances like Kelsey Grammar’s Stinky Pete or main protagonists like Tom Hanks and Tim Allen as Woody and Buzz Lightyear, Pixar always manages to obtain some recognizable faces for their movies. With the 4th installment around the corner, they’re now expected to include a few appearances from true comedic legends.

It was recently announced that four iconic comedians- Carol Burnett, Mel Brooks, Betty White and Carl Reiner- will briefly cameo in Toy Story 4 as abandoned toys. Their names will be a combination of the actors and the toy’s animal forms, including Melephant Brooks, Bitey White, Chairol Burnett and Carl Reinerorceros. These actors have had some voice acting experience during the past decade, including White in The Lorax and Brooks in the Hotel Transylvania movies. However, it’s uncommon to see all four appear together, especially in one of the most recognizable animated franchises of all time. Yet they all seem rather happy to cameo, with Reiner mentioning that “To be represented by a cute little toy character is not the worst thing in the world.”

It’s unknown how long these cameos will last, but it’ll likely add to Toy Story 4‘s star power, Director Josh Cooley drew inspiration for the characters through his experiences with his kids, stating “Sometimes toys fall in and out of favor. I look at my own kid and stuff that was the favorite toy yesterday is now in the closet.” Woody’s interactions with them will likely add to the world building and exploration of what it is like to be a lost toy.

Toy Story 4 will be released on June 21st 2019.
